SSC CHSL Age Limit
Every candidate applying online for the SSC CHSL Examination 2025 must fulfill the following age criteria. Candidates should note that the SSC will only accept the date of birth as recorded on the Matriculation/Secondary Examination Certificate or an equivalent certificate available at the time of submission.
The minimum and maximum age requirements are as follows:
Age Criteria | Details |
---|
Minimum Age | 18 years |
Maximum Age | 27 years |
Date of Birth Range | Born between 2nd August 1997 and 1st August 2006 (As per Last Year Notification) |
Age Relaxation | Applicable for candidates belonging to reserved categories as per SSC rules |

SSC CHSL Age Relaxation Criteria
According to the rules of the exam, SSC CHSL permits age relaxation. The key points regarding the relaxation of the upper age limit for candidates from reserved categories are as follows:
Category | Age Relaxation |
---|
SC/ST | 5 years |
OBC | 3 years |
Persons with Disabilities (PwD-Unreserved) | 10 years |
PWD (OBC) | 13 years |
PwD (SC/ST) | 15 years |
Ex-Servicemen | 3 years (after deducting military service) |
Domiciled in Jammu & Kashmir (1st Jan 1980 – 31st Dec 1989) | 5 years |
Disabled Defense Personnel | 3 years |
Disabled Defense Personnel (SC/ST) | 8 years |
Central Govt. Employees (3+ years of service) | Up to 40 years |
Central Govt. Employees (3+ years of service, SC/ST) | Up to 45 years |
Widows/Divorced Women/Judicially Separated Women | Up to 35 years |
Widows/Divorced Women/Judicially Separated Women (SC/ST) | Up to 40 years |

SSC CHSL Nationality
To be eligible for the SSC CHSL exam, candidates need to meet certain nationality requirements and have proof of it. Candidates must belong to one of the following nationalities:
Category | Eligibility Criteria |
---|
Indian Citizen | Must be a citizen of India. |
Nepalese Citizen | Must be a subject of Nepal. |
Bhutanese Citizen | Must be a subject of Bhutan. |
Tibetan Refugee | Came to India before 1st January 1962, intending to settle permanently. |
Person of Indian Origin | Migrated from Burma, Pakistan, Sri Lanka, Kenya, Tanzania, Uganda, Zaire, Ethiopia, Zambia, Malawi, or Vietnam to settle permanently in India. |

SSC CHSL Post Wise Educational Qualification
The details of the SSC CHSL Educational Qualification for each post have been provided in the table below:
Post Name | Educational Qualification |
---|
LDC/ JSA, DEO (except DEOs in C&AG) | Passed 12th Standard or equivalent exam from a recognized Board or University. |
Data Entry Operator (DEO Grade ‘A') | Passed 12th Standard pass in Science stream with Mathematics as a subject from a recognized Board or equivalent. |
SSC CHSL Permitted Physical Disabilities
Candidates with special abilities may also apply for certain positions in the SSC CHSL exam. However, there are certain parameters that candidates must consider before applying. Check the SSC CHSL eligibility for physically challenged candidates for the following positions:
Post | SSC CHSL Eligibility for Physically Challenged Candidates |
---|
Data Entry Operator | One Arm Affected (OA), One Leg Affected (OL), One arm and one leg affected (OAL), Both Leg Affected (BL), Hearing Handicapped (HH), and Low Vision (LV) are eligible for the post of Data Entry Operator. |
Lower Division Clerk/ Junior Secretariat Assistant | One Arm Affected (OA), Both Legs Affected (BL), One Leg Affected (OL), One arm and one leg affected (OAL), Blind (B), Low Vision (LV) & Hearing Handicapped (HH), are eligible for the post of Lower Division Clerk & Junior Secretariat Assistant |
SSC CHSL Physical and Medical Standards For LDC in BRO
For candidates applying for the position of Lower Division Clerk in the Border Roads Organization (BRO) under SSC CHSL 2025, it is essential to meet certain physical and medical standards. These standards are necessary to ensure that candidates are physically fit for the demands of the role.
- Physical Efficiency Test (PET): Candidates must complete a one-mile run within 10 minutes. This test is compulsory for all candidates.
- Medical Examination: Candidates will undergo a medical test to check their physical fitness, including vision, height, weight, and chest measurements.
- Temporary Medical Unfitness: Candidates found temporarily unfit can appeal for a re-medical test.
- Permanent Medical Unfitness: Candidates declared permanently unfit will not be considered for final selection.
- Medical Exam Attendance: Candidates must attend the medical test on the assigned date. Absence will lead to cancellation of the application.
- Final Selection: Only candidates who pass the medical test and meet all physical & medical standards will move forward in the recruitment process.
